The history of pregnancy testing, and how it transformed from an esoteric laboratory tool to a commonplace of everyday life. Pregnancy testing has never been easier. Waiting on one side or the other of the bathroom door for a “positive” or “negative” result has become a modern ritual and rite of passage. Today, the ubiquitous home pregnancy test is implicated in personal decisions and public debates about all aspects of reproduction, from miscarriage and abortion to the “biological clock” and IVF. Yet, only three generations ago, women typically waited not minutes but months to find out whether they were pregnant. A Woman’s Right to Know tells, for the first time, the story of pregnancy testing—one of the most significant and least studied technologies of reproduction.Focusing on Britain from around 1900 to the present day, Jesse Olszynko-Gryn shows how demand shifted from doctors to women, and then goes further to explain the remarkable transformation of pregnancy testing from an obscure laboratory service to an easily accessible (though fraught) tool for every woman. Lastly, the book reflects on resources the past might contain for the present and future of sexual and reproductive health.Solidly researched and compellingly argued, Olszynko-Gryn demonstrates that the rise of pregnancy testing has had significant—and not always expected—impact and has led to changes in the ways in which we conceive of pregnancy itself.

A completely revised edition, offering new design recipes for interactive programs and support for images as plain values, testing, event-driven programming, and even distributed programming. This introduction to programming places computer science at the core of a liberal arts education. Unlike other introductory books, it focuses on the program design process, presenting program design guidelines that show the reader how to analyze a problem statement, how to formulate concise goals, how to make up examples, how to develop an outline of the solution, how to finish the program, and how to test it. Because learning to design programs is about the study of principles and the acquisition of transferable skills, the text does not use an off-the-shelf industrial language but presents a tailor-made teaching language. For the same reason, it offers DrRacket, a programming environment for novices that supports playful, feedback-oriented learning. The environment grows with readers as they master the material in the book until it supports a full-fledged language for the whole spectrum of programming tasks. This second edition has been completely revised. While the book continues to teach a systematic approach to program design, the second edition introduces different design recipes for interactive programs with graphical interfaces and batch programs. It also enriches its design recipes for functions with numerous new hints. Finally, the teaching languages and their IDE now come with support for images as plain values, testing, event-driven programming, and even distributed programming.

A comprehensive presentation of essential topics for biological engineers, focusing on the development and application of dynamic models of biomolecular and cellular phenomena. This book describes the fundamental molecular and cellular events responsible for biological function, develops models to study biomolecular and cellular phenomena, and shows, with examples, how models are applied in the design and interpretation of experiments on biological systems. Integrating molecular cell biology with quantitative engineering analysis and design, it is the first textbook to offer a comprehensive presentation of these essential topics for chemical and biological engineering. The book systematically develops the concepts necessary to understand and study complex biological phenomena, moving from the simplest elements at the smallest scale and progressively adding complexity at the cellular organizational level, focusing on experimental testing of mechanistic hypotheses. After introducing the motivations for formulation of mathematical rate process models in biology, the text goes on to cover such topics as noncovalent binding interactions; quantitative descriptions of the transient, steady state, and equilibrium interactions of proteins and their ligands; enzyme kinetics; gene expression and protein trafficking; network dynamics; quantitative descriptions of growth dynamics; coupled transport and reaction; and discrete stochastic processes. The textbook is intended for advanced undergraduate and graduate courses in chemical engineering and bioengineering, and has been developed by the authors for classes they teach at MIT and the University of Minnesota.

The first comprehensive textbook on regression modeling for linguistic data offers an incisive conceptual overview along with worked examples that teach practical skills for realistic data analysis. In the first comprehensive textbook on regression modeling for linguistic data in a frequentist framework, Morgan Sonderegger provides graduate students and researchers with an incisive conceptual overview along with worked examples that teach practical skills for realistic data analysis . The book features extensive treatment of mixed-effects regression models, the most widely used statistical method for analyzing linguistic data. Sonderegger begins with preliminaries to regression modeling: assumptions, inferential statistics, hypothesis testing, power, and other errors. He then covers regression models for non-clustered data: linear regression, model selection and validation, logistic regression, and applied topics such as contrast coding and nonlinear effects. The last three chapters discuss regression models for clustered data: linear and logistic mixed-effects models as well as model predictions, convergence, and model selection. The book’s focused scope and practical emphasis will equip readers to implement these methods and understand how they are used in current work. - The only advanced discussion of modeling for linguists - Uses R throughout, in practical examples using real datasets - Extensive treatment of mixed-effects regression models - Contains detailed, clear guidance on reporting models - Equal emphasis on observational data and data from controlled experiments - Suitable for graduate students and researchers with computational interests across linguistics and cognitive science

How ed tech was born: Twentieth-century teaching machines--from Sidney Pressey''s mechanized test-giver to B. F. Skinner''s behaviorist bell-ringing box. Contrary to popular belief, ed tech did not begin with videos on the internet. The idea of technology that would allow students to "go at their own pace" did not originate in Silicon Valley. In Teaching Machines, education writer Audrey Watters offers a lively history of predigital educational technology, from Sidney Pressey''s mechanized positive-reinforcement provider to B. F. Skinner''s behaviorist bell-ringing box. Watters shows that these machines and the pedagogy that accompanied them sprang from ideas--bite-sized content, individualized instruction--that had legs and were later picked up by textbook publishers and early advocates for computerized learning. Watters pays particular attention to the role of the media--newspapers, magazines, television, and film--in shaping people''s perceptions of teaching machines as well as the psychological theories underpinning them. She considers these machines in the context of education reform, the political reverberations of Sputnik, and the rise of the testing and textbook industries. She chronicles Skinner''s attempts to bring his teaching machines to market, culminating in the famous behaviorist''s efforts to launch Didak 101, the "pre-verbal" machine that taught spelling. (Alternate names proposed by Skinner include "Autodidak," "Instructomat," and "Autostructor.") Telling these somewhat cautionary tales, Watters challenges what she calls "the teleology of ed tech"--the idea that not only is computerized education inevitable, but technological progress is the sole driver of events.

A study of Group Material, the influential but underexamined New York–based artist collective, investigating a series of key works. Key predecessor of contemporary art’s most radical activist gestures, the 1980s collective Group Material seized upon the temporary exhibition as a prime mode of intervention. Projects sited on walls, subways, and billboards targeted some of the most sensitive political conflicts of the era, from U.S. military interventions in Latin America to the AIDS crisis. In Art Demonstration , Claire Grace examines Group Material’s New York–based collaboration across a decade that saw a wave of renewed interest in art as a domain of political mobilization. As Grace argues here, Group Material’s art was never just a means to an end; looking itself held urgency. Grace distinguishes between two types of Group Material projects: room-scale interiors featuring distinctive wall treatments, soundtracks, and boundary-crossing arrangements of objects, and works in spaces usually reserved for advertising. Grace analyzes the group’s practice in both categories, examining such well-known projects as AIDS Timeline (1989) and Democracy (1988–1989) and lesser-known works including Subculture (1983) and The Castle (1987). Grace shows that the politics running through Group Material’s practice ultimately resides in the artists’ particular recourse to the exhibition form. With that bearing, Group Material’s work insisted on the material in the face of postmodern theory’s privileging of the discursive, and redistributed authorship within protean and pivotally diverse collective structures, testing in so doing the ever fragile contours of democratic participation as art became a commodity for speculative investment.

A substantially revised fourth edition of a comprehensive textbook, including new coverage of recent advances in deep learning and neural networks. The goal of machine learning is to program computers to use example data or past experience to solve a given problem. Machine learning underlies such exciting new technologies as self-driving cars, speech recognition, and translation applications. This substantially revised fourth edition of a comprehensive, widely used machine learning textbook offers new coverage of recent advances in the field in both theory and practice, including developments in deep learning and neural networks. The book covers a broad array of topics not usually included in introductory machine learning texts, including supervised learning, Bayesian decision theory, parametric methods, semiparametric methods, nonparametric methods, multivariate analysis, hidden Markov models, reinforcement learning, kernel machines, graphical models, Bayesian estimation, and statistical testing. The fourth edition offers a new chapter on deep learning that discusses training, regularizing, and structuring deep neural networks such as convolutional and generative adversarial networks; new material in the chapter on reinforcement learning that covers the use of deep networks, the policy gradient methods, and deep reinforcement learning; new material in the chapter on multilayer perceptrons on autoencoders and the word2vec network; and discussion of a popular method of dimensionality reduction, t-SNE. New appendixes offer background material on linear algebra and optimization. End-of-chapter exercises help readers to apply concepts learned. Introduction to Machine Learning can be used in courses for advanced undergraduate and graduate students and as a reference for professionals.

A new approach to safety, based on systems thinking, that is more effective, less costly, and easier to use than current techniques. Engineering has experienced a technological revolution, but the basic engineering techniques applied in safety and reliability engineering, created in a simpler, analog world, have changed very little over the years. In this groundbreaking book, Nancy Leveson proposes a new approach to safety—more suited to today''s complex, sociotechnical, software-intensive world—based on modern systems thinking and systems theory. Revisiting and updating ideas pioneered by 1950s aerospace engineers in their System Safety concept, and testing her new model extensively on real-world examples, Leveson has created a new approach to safety that is more effective, less expensive, and easier to use than current techniques. Arguing that traditional models of causality are inadequate, Leveson presents a new, extended model of causation (Systems-Theoretic Accident Model and Processes, or STAMP), then shows how the new model can be used to create techniques for system safety engineering, including accident analysis, hazard analysis, system design, safety in operations, and management of safety-critical systems. She applies the new techniques to real-world events including the friendly-fire loss of a U.S. Blackhawk helicopter in the first Gulf War; the Vioxx recall; the U.S. Navy SUBSAFE program; and the bacterial contamination of a public water supply in a Canadian town. Leveson''s approach is relevant even beyond safety engineering, offering techniques for “reengineering” any large sociotechnical system to improve safety and manage risk.

A probing examination of the dynamic history of predictive methods and values in science and engineering that helps us better understand today’s cultures of prediction. The ability to make reliable predictions based on robust and replicable methods is a defining feature of the scientific endeavor, allowing engineers to determine whether a building will stand up or where a cannonball will strike. Cultures of Prediction , which bridges history and philosophy, uncovers the dynamic history of prediction in science and engineering over four centuries. Ann Johnson and Johannes Lenhard identify four different cultures, or modes, of prediction in the history of science and engineering: rational, empirical, iterative-numerical, and exploratory-iterative. They show how all four develop together and interact with one another while emphasizing that mathematization is not a single unitary process, but one that has taken many forms.The story is not one of the triumph of abstract mathematics or technology, but of how different modes of prediction, complementary concepts of mathematization, and technology coevolved, building what the authors call “cultures of prediction.” The first part of the book examines prediction from early modernity up to the computer age. The second part probes computer-related cultures of prediction, which focus on making things and testing their performance, often in computer simulations. This new orientation challenges basic tenets of the philosophy of science, in which scientific theories and models are predominantly seen as explanatory rather than predictive. It also influences the types of research projects that scientists and engineers undertake, as well as which ones receive support from funding agencies.

An engaging introduction to the use of game theory to study lingistic meaning. In Meaningful Games , Robin Clark explains in an accessible manner the usefulness of game theory in thinking about a wide range of issues in linguistics. Clark argues that we use grammar strategically to signal our intended meanings: our choices as speaker are conditioned by what choices the hearer will make interpreting what we say. Game theory—according to which the outcome of a decision depends on the choices of others—provides a formal system that allows us to develop theories about the kind of decision making that is crucial to understanding linguistic behavior.Clark argues the only way to understand meaning is to grapple with its social nature—that it is the social that gives content to our mental lives. Game theory gives us a framework for working out these ideas. The resulting theory of use will allow us to account for many aspects of linguistic meaning, and the grammar itself can be simplified. The results are nevertheless precise and subject to empirical testing. Meaningful Games offers an engaging and accessible introduction to game theory and the study of linguistic meaning. No knowledge of mathematics beyond simple algebra is required; formal definitions appear in special boxes outside the main text. The book includes an extended argument in favor of the social basis of meaning; a brief introduction to game theory, with a focus on coordination games and cooperation; discussions of common knowledge and games of partial information; models of games for pronouns and politeness; and the development of a system of social coordination of reference.

A collection that explores how architecture ought to negotiate the future, when the future is anything but certain. Architecture is fundamentally a practice of predicting the future. In designing spaces that will endure for decades, architects must reconcile their visions of future living with predicted economic, political, and environmental futures. Thus, whereas utopian architects of the past each sought to impose a singular future through visionary architectural form, architects of today must reconcile between the multiple futures projected by hired specialists, live modeling software, climate change prognoses, and financial markets. Perspecta 55 aims to undertake this much-needed analysis of contrasting techniques of prediction, investigating architecture’s relationship to these conflicting visions of the future. Perspecta gathers together contributions from the fields of finance, climate, security, and computation to unearth the particular disciplinary histories and social values that underlie future projection. They identify eight futurological modes with direct impact on architectural practice: the hypothetical speculation of scenario planning, the training drills of disaster preparation, the logic of resisting a certain future evident within resiliency, the imaginings of science fiction, the risks and profits of the financial futures market, techniques of building information modeling and simulation, the algorithmic prediction involved in data mining, and the future-reversing logic of repair.In investigating and testing practices of future prediction, Perspecta 55 hopes to empower architecture to address its uncertain, contested futures so that it may successfully reconcile and articulate its own future.
